Yimaphi ama-wavelength angcono kakhulu ekwelapheni i-UV LED? Kodwa-ke, kuphephile ukucabanga ukuthi i-365 nm, i-385 nm, i-395 nm, ne-405 nm izohlanganisa izinhlelo zokusebenza eziningi zezohwebo nezimboni. I-wavelength ngayinye ye-UV inezinzuzo zayo, futhi lokhu kufanele kucatshangelwe. Ububanzi be-wavelength ye- 365nm nm kuya ku-405nm kufanele ifane nohlelo lokusebenza oludingekayo ukufeza izinhloso ezingcono, njengokunciphisa izindleko nokukhulisa ukusebenza. Inqubo yama-wavelengths kanye nokusebenza kwe-photochemical Ukuphulukiswa kwe-UV LED kungakhipha ukusabela kwe-photochemical kuma-glues, ukumboza, ngisho nama-inks ngokusetshenziswa kokukhanya kwe-UV, okunamathiselayo, ukumboza, nama-inks. Ama-wavelengths asetshenziswa kakhulu ekuphulukiseni i-UV LED afaka: Lawa ma-wavelengths awela ebangeni le-UVA (315-400 nm), elisetshenziswa kabanzi ezinhlelweni zokuphulukisa i-ultraviolet ngenxa yokusebenza kwayo nokuphepha.  Izici ezithinta ukukhethwa kwe-wavelength 1. Ukuhambisana kwezinto ezibonakalayo Ama-photoinitiators, izinto zokwakha, kanye nezakhi zazo zokwakha ziphendula kalula kuma-wavelengths athile. Isibonelo, ezinye izinamathiselo nokugqoka zenziwa ukuba ziphulukise ngaphansi kokukhanya kwe-365nm; Kodwa-ke, okunye ukwakheka kungadinga i-395nm noma i-405 nm ukuze isebenze kangcono.  2. Ukwelapha ukujula nesivinini Ama-wavelengths amafushane, afana ne-365nm, angena ezintweni ngaphezulu, okwenza kube kuhle ukwelapha izinto ezijiyile noma ezingabonakali. Ngakolunye uhlangothi, ama-wavelengths amade, afana ne-405nm, amuncwa kakhulu ebusweni bokufa. Lokhu kuholela ekuphulukisweni okusheshayo komhlaba.  3.
